Gold & silver

Red 5 continues construction and development activities at King of the Hills

November saw a flurry of activity at King of the Hills, the company's flagship gold project in Western Australia, where construction continues to deadline and budget.

Red 5 Ltd (ASX:RED) is progressing well towards its scheduled first production from the King of the Hills Gold Project in the June quarter of 2022.

The company has completed another month of construction and development at the 100%-owned 2.4-million-ounce project in Western Australia.

Construction on the mine, which is expected to have a 16-year lifespan, progressed well in November. A raft of tasks is underway, including:

  • Installation of the 36-foot diameter semi-autogenous grinding (SAG) mill;
  • Positioning of the plant control room on the carbon-in-leach (CIL) tank platform;
  • Installation of the stacker conveyor, the truss sections for conveyors, and the gyratory crusher’s bottom shell, mantle, top shell and ROM bin;
  • Construction of the ROM wall;
  • Painting of the interior and exterior walls of the CIL tanks; and
  • Completion of the stockpile reclaim tunnel and two apron feeders.

SAG mill shell, motors, girth gear, mill lubrication skid and process plant control room now in position.

Power to the King

The power station switch room and engine hall are now in place, with two gas engines and diesel generators for the plant start-up installed. Four Jenbacher 624 engines were installed in the engine hall in early December.

Delivery and installation of the Jenbacher gas turbine engines as at December 6 (pictured within Zenith’s power station building).

Fifty power transmission poles for the plant-to-village power corridor have been erected to date.

The company has also completed the hot tap into the Goldfields Gas Pipeline. Installation of the 13-kilometre gas lateral pipeline is in train and should be completed by February of the coming year.

On track to first gold

“We didn’t miss a beat during November, as key elements of this new state-of-the-art gold mine take shape," managing director Mark Williams said.

“Some of the more notable achievements during November included significant progress with the installation of the imposing 36-foot diameter SAG mill, the arrival of the process plant control room and erection of the stacker conveyor.

“The site continues to be a hive of activity as we power on towards our goal of achieving first gold production in the June quarter of 2022 – the countdown to production is well and truly on.”

Earthworks for the wall lift on Tailings Storage Facility 4A and 4B are also nearing completion.

More updates are expected in January as the company moves closer to first gold production.
